FDA v. Wages and White Lion Investments, LLC

  • Resumen

  • In this case, the court considered this issue: Was the Food and Drug Administration’s orders denying respondents’ applications for authorization to market new e-cigarette products arbitrary and capricious, in violation of the Administrative Procedure Act?

    The case was decided on April 2, 2025

    The Court unanimously held that the FDA's decisions were neither arbitrary nor capricious. Specifically, the Court agreed with the FDA's assessment that the manufacturers failed to demonstrate that the benefits of their flavored products to adult smokers outweighed the risks to youth. This ruling reversed a prior decision by the Fifth Circuit Court of Appeals, which had found the FDA's denials unwarranted. The Supreme Court's decision underscores the FDA's authority to regulate tobacco products, particularly those appealing to younger audiences, in line with public health objectives.
